Dear support,

I have Wingate 6 installed and I need to configure an iPhone 3G to receive the emails.

So I configured a POP account in the iPhone and it worked just fine, but when the user uses the Wingate account to access the internet and the iPhone gets the messages, it causes the lock account error message. So I have to stop the Wingate and manually delete the LockFile that is at the user mail directory.

Could you help me to solve this issue ??

Re: Wingate 6 Email + iPhone 3G

Jul 08 09 10:49 am

OK

If there is still a connection to the POP3 server on that maibox, it will keep the lock file. The lock file is meant to be deleted only when the session ends.

you can right-click in the activity screen, and view by service, that will show you all POP3 connections in the same place - may make it easier to see.

Re: Wingate 6 Email + iPhone 3G

Jul 09 09 12:12 pm

each user account / mailbox can only be either POP3 or IMAP.

IMAP however allows multiple concurrent logins, so even just changing to IMAP could help.

iPhones support IMAP as well.
